About Livent: Livent powers the things that power our lives. From the revolution in electric vehicle batteries and mobile devices to the strong, lightweight alloys and advanced polymers that take innovation further, we harness lithium technology to help the world move forward-cleaner, healthier and more sustainably.

For nearly eight decades, we've been harnessing lithium's potential to change the energy landscape. We are a pioneer in the lithium industry and have a rich history of breakthrough innovations and industry achievements, including partnering with Sony Corporation to develop the first ever Lithium-ion battery for commercial use.

Today, Livent builds on our heritage and is a global leader in the lithium industry with a differentiated product offering, proven track record and sustainability profile. Our customer portfolio includes some of the most dynamic companies in the world, including Tesla, and BMW Group.

Position Summary: Responsible for the control and accuracy of all inventory as it relates to all system transactions.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Schedule and conduct Cycle Counts
  • Analyze and reconcile inventory discrepancies and determines root causes
  • Make inventory adjustments upon approval by management, and/or work with areas to correct production transactions
  • Record and track inventory accuracy for weekly KPIs
  • Play a major role in assisting the facilitation of the annual physical inventory
  • Provide support for production confirmation/backflush processes as needed
  • Research inventory discrepancies as needed
  • Assist areas improve the recording of inventory transactions, as appropriate
  • Proactively request training or tools required to perform job better
  • Follow all company guidelines for safety in the workplace
  • Have a compliance mindset with understanding of corporate policy
  • Perform other duties as assigned by management.
